> How to measure? Easy. Disconnect any input transformer
> or cartridge. Measure the voltage across the 47K input
> resistor, divide by 47K and that's your input grid current.

Too much hassle, I have around 700 Ohm DCR in the gridcircuit (transfomer & gridstopper) and the grid is well below 1mV and thus below 1uA.

It does not worry me. I was worrid it may lead to too much non-linearity but 'scope & fft are clean enough, sounds great too.
